WebSep 27, 2024 · Automaticity: the ability to spontaneously depolarize and generate an action potential. Conduction: movement of a cardiac action potential from one part of the heart to another. Contractility: the potential to do work, often measured as the ability of muscle tissue to develop tension or shorten.

WebSep 14, 2024 · What causes increased automaticity? The automaticity in the sinoatrial node increases during physical exercise. The increased automaticity is a normal reaction since the cardiac output must increase during exercise. This is an example of normal (physiological) increase in automaticity. This will increase heart rate, which will increase cardiac output, which will increase blood pressure. Increased sympathetic activity will increase SA node automaticity and AV node conduction velocity resulting in increased heart rate. WebNov 7, 2016 · Abnormal automaticity includes both reduced automaticity, which causes bradycardia, and increased automaticity, which causes tachycardia. Arrhythmias caused by abnormal automaticity can result from diverse mechanisms (see Figs. 6.1 and 6.2). The cardiac action potential is a brief change in voltage (membrane potential) across the cell membrane of heart cells. This is caused by the movement of charged atoms (called ions) between the inside and outside of the cell, through proteins called ion channels. The cardiac action potential differs from action potentials found in other types of electrically excitable cells, such as nerves.
